| + // Track various API calls and results. |
| + enum Events { |
| + // Number of statements run, either with sql::Statement or Execute*(). |
| + EVENT_STATEMENT_RUN = 0, |
| + |
| + // Number of rows returned by statements run. |
| + EVENT_STATEMENT_ROWS, |
| + |
| + // Number of statements successfully run (all steps returned SQLITE_DONE or |
| + // SQLITE_ROW). |
| + EVENT_STATEMENT_SUCCESS, |
| + |
| + // Number of statements run by Execute() or ExecuteAndReturnErrorCode(). |
| + EVENT_EXECUTE, |
| + |
| + // Number of rows changed by autocommit statements. |
| + EVENT_CHANGES_AUTOCOMMIT, |
| + |
| + // Number of rows changed by statements in transactions. |
| + EVENT_CHANGES, |
| + |
| + // Count actual SQLite transaction statements (not including nesting). |
| + EVENT_BEGIN, |
| + EVENT_COMMIT, |
| + EVENT_ROLLBACK, |
| + |
| + // Leave this at the end. |
| + // TODO(shess): |EVENT_MAX| causes compile fail on Windows. |
| + EVENT_MX |
| + }; |
| + void RecordEvent(Events event, size_t count); |
| + void RecordOneEvent(Events event) { |
| + RecordEvent(event, 1); |
| + } |

| + // Record time in DML (Data Manipulation Language) statements such as INSERT |
| + // or UPDATE outside of an explicit transaction. Due to implementation |
| + // limitations time spent on DDL (Data Definition Language) statements such as |
| + // ALTER and CREATE is not included. |
| + void AutoCommitTime(const base::TimeDelta& delta); |
| + |
| + // Record all time spent on updating the database. This includes CommitTime() |
| + // and AutoCommitTime(), plus any time spent spilling to the journal if |
| + // transactions do not fit in cache. |
| + void UpdateTime(const base::TimeDelta& delta); |
| + |
| + // Record all time spent running statements, including time spent doing |
| + // updates and time spent on read-only queries. |
| + void QueryTime(const base::TimeDelta& delta); |
| + |
| + // Record |delta| as query time if |read_only| (from sqlite3_stmt_readonly) is |
| + // true, autocommit time if the database is not in a transaction, or update |
| + // time if the database is in a transaction. Also records change count to |
| + // EVENT_CHANGES_AUTOCOMMIT or EVENT_CHANGES_COMMIT. |
| + void ChangeHelper(const base::TimeDelta& delta, bool read_only); |
